Frequently asked questions about Duxbury Middle

How many students attend Duxbury Middle?

Duxbury Middle has 599 students enrolled. It is a middle school in Duxbury, MA. CCD year-over-year: 623 (2022-23) → 623 (2023-24), nearly flat (+0).

What is the student-teacher ratio at Duxbury Middle?

The student-teacher ratio at Duxbury Middle is 12.2:1, which is 1% lower than the Massachusetts average of 12.3:1 and 22% lower than the national average of 15.7:1. Lower ratios generally mean more individual attention per student.

What is the racial and ethnic makeup of Duxbury Middle?

The largest demographic group at Duxbury Middle is White at 92.8% of enrollment, in Duxbury, MA.

What is the Resource Investment Index for Duxbury Middle?

Duxbury Middle has a Resource Investment Index of 56/100 (higher reported resources relative to schools nationally) based on 4 factors: student-teacher ratio, gifted-program reporting, counselor availability, chronic absenteeism. Not a test-score or academic measure (national median ~41/100, see methodology).

How does Duxbury Middle rank among public schools in Duxbury?

By Resource Investment Index, Duxbury Middle ranks #1 of 4 public schools in Duxbury, MA. This compares federal resource and staffing data among local peers; it is not a test-score or academic ranking.

What other schools are in Duxbury?

Besides Duxbury Middle, Duxbury also operates Duxbury High (808 students), Chandler Elementary (665 students), and Alden School (622 students). See the Duxbury district page for the complete list.
